biography of Emilio CABALLERO (1917-2010)

Birth place: Newark, NJ

Addresses: Amarillo, TX

Profession: Educator, painter

Studied: Amarillo Col., AA, 1940; W. Tex. State Univ., BA, 1942; Columbia Univ., MA, 1949, DEd., 1955.

Exhibited: Tex. Oil 1958, Dallas Pub. Lib., Tex., 1958; Tex. Fine Arts Circuit Show, 1968; 104th Ann. Am. WC Soc. Exhib., 1971; 9th Ann. Southwestern Exhib. Prints & Drawings, Dallas; Mid-Am. Ann., William Parkhill Nelson Gallery, Kansas City; Canyon Art Gallery, Canyon, TX, 1970s. Awards: Accolade Award for 20 Yrs. Art, Amarillo Globe Times, 1962; Kappa Pi Gold Plaque Hall of Fame, 1970.

Member: Fel. Royal Soc. Great Britain; Llano Estacado Heritage N. Mex. (art ed. 1970); Soc. Archit. Historians; Soc. Art Ther.

Work: Col. Southwest, Hobbs, N. Mex; Lovett Mem. Lib., Pampa, Tex.; St. Anne's Cath. Church, Canyon, Tex.; YWCA, Amarillo, Tex.; Pampa Youth Ctr. Commissions: mosaic facade, Tex. Midland Pub. Lib., 1958; copper enamels, Amarillo Savings & Loan, 1968, Hosea Foster Ins. Co., 1969, Amarillo Munic Bldg., 1969 & Bank Southwest, Midland, 1970.

Comments: Preferred media: watercolors, enamel. Positions: art consult., Agnes Russell Ctr., Columbia Univ., 1951-1952; consult. art, Ed. Comt. Amarillo Art Alliance, 1970-; lectr., Friends of Fine Arts, 1970-. Teaching: Spec. art instr., Amarillo Pub. Schs., 1946-1949; prof. art & chmn. dept., W. Tex. State Univ., 1949-, faculty excellence award, 1972. Publications: contribr., Expression through Puppetry," Tex. Outlook, 1947; contribr., "Evocative Painting," Design, 1949; contribr., Watercolor Painting in Elementary Grades (Am. Crayon Co., 1949).

Sources: WW73; Elsie Wilbanks, Art on the Texas Plains (Lubbock Art Assn., 1959); L. Sumner, "Plains Party Line," Amarillo Globe News, 1960; G. Denko, "Caballero Heads Festival," Amarillo Globe, 1970."
